School Achievement: Thinking About What to Test.
Haertel, Edward; Calfee, Robert
Journal of Educational Measurement, v20 n2 p119-32 Sum 1983
The history of the relation between achievement tests and curriculum programs is reviewed, and it is concluded that content specialists are best qualified as sources of curricular goals to specify content, kinds of attainment, and standards. The specification of instructional intents is also considered from the perspective of modern cognition psychology. (Author/CM)
